Key Responsibilities

  • Monitor and analyse daily market, credit, and operational risk exposures across physical and derivatives oil trading portfolios
  • Perform daily P&L validation, position reconciliation, and exposure reporting for trading desks
  • Ensure accurate valuation and independent risk oversight of trading books, including mark-to-market and VaR reporting
  • Partner closely with traders, operations, finance, and compliance teams to resolve discrepancies and improve controls
  • Support trade lifecycle monitoring, including deal capture validation, inventory positions, hedging effectiveness, and exposure limits
  • Produce management reports and risk analytics for senior stakeholders
  • Assist in the enhancement of risk frameworks, reporting tools, and process automation initiatives
  • Monitor limit utilisation and escalate breaches or unusual trading patterns where appropriate
  • Contribute to process improvements across the middle office and risk infrastructure
